Transaction 57cccd317cc0fd50d5ddfa2292b10fd5953aa2a82cdfd2c15ee39c774744f719

1 Input
2 Outputs
  • 57cccd317cc0fd50d5ddfa2292b10fd5953aa2a82cdfd2c15ee39c774744f719:0
  • value  586747
    address  3Q5DQLSwro9CCmixgEwXbb2MsCfmqgUrFn
  • 57cccd317cc0fd50d5ddfa2292b10fd5953aa2a82cdfd2c15ee39c774744f719:1
  • value  184245641
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v